WebOct 19, 2024 · Change folder to netappfiles-powershell-smb-script-sample\src\Basic; Open CreateANFVolume and edit all the parameters; Save and close; Run the following command; CreateANFVolume.ps1 OR. Advanced mode - More advanced way to run the script to create Azure Netapp Files with validation using modules WebApr 3, 2024 · Install the Az module for the current user only. This is the recommended installation scope. This method works the same on Windows, Linux, and macOS platforms. Run the following command from a PowerShell session: PowerShell. Install-Module -Name Az -Scope CurrentUser -Repository PSGallery -Force.
